Output 180c705a58f01782f23991eaab8b285876a6231a433b920f493497cac17f66a2:1

value
13437800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1863e7843d09a69c81b048bf46e8ebfc395d44a OP_EQUAL
address
3KLHA1FsDzJeELZF8eBouh7ZHDt3Z8ntKs
transaction
180c705a58f01782f23991eaab8b285876a6231a433b920f493497cac17f66a2
spent
true